Siemens與FANUC手動編程的區別

手動編程訓練

第一章 2D程式

  • 標準程式頭與程式尾

Siemens

T1D1

FFWON

G64

SOFT

˙

˙

FFWOF

M30

FANUC

G91G28Z0.

G90G40G49G80

G90G00G54X0.Y0.

˙

˙

˙

˙

M30

一﹑普通結構

主副程式呼叫 格式

Siemens

G90G55G00Z150.

X0Y0

M03S6000

Z10

G01Z0F2000

AAA P10

G00Z150.

X0Y0

M30

Fanuc

G90G55G00Z150.

X0.Y0.

M03S6000

Z10.

G01Z0F2000

M98 P1 L10

G00Z150.

X0.Y0.

M30

直接呼叫 AAA 副程式﹐P10表示呼叫10次

用M98呼叫O0001程式﹐L10表示呼叫10次

副程式 名稱

Siemens系統程式命名較隨意﹐可有字母或數字命名﹐但命名最好

不要以代碼等與系統有沖突的名字來命名。

Fanuc系統所有程式命名都是以O開頭﹐後跟程式名編號﹐如﹕

O0001,O0002等﹐呼叫時可寫P0001(或P1)﹑P0002(或P2)

練習 1

銑圓

副程式:

Siemens與FANUC手動編程的區別

SPF1:(O0002)

G91G01Z-0.5F2000

G01G41D01X6.

G03I-6.J0.

G40G01X-6.

M17(M99)

主程式(西門子):

FFWON

SOFT

G64

T1D1

G90G00G54Z150.

X0.Y0.

M03S7000

Z100.

G01Z0.F2000

SPF1 P10

G90G00Z150.

FFWOF

M30

主程式Fanuc

G91G28Z0.

G90G40G49G80

G00G54Z150.

X0.Y0.

M03S7000

G00Z100.

G01Z0.F2000

M98 P2 L10

G90G00Z150.

M30

練習 2

銑槽

主程式(西門子):

Siemens與FANUC手動編程的區別

FFWON

SOFT

G64

T1D1

G90G00G54Z150.

X0.Y0.

M03S7000

Z100.

G01Z0.F2000

SPF1 P20

G90G00Z150.

FFWOF

M30

FANUC

G91G28Z0.

G90G40G49G80

G00G54Z150.

X0.Y0.

M03S7000

G00Z100.

G01Z0.F2000

M98 P2 L20

G90G00Z150.

M30

副程式:

西門子( FANUC)

SPF1:(O0002)

G91G01Z-0.6F2000

G01G41D01X17.

Y8.

G03X-1.Y1.I0.J-1.

G01X-32.

G03X-1.Y-1.I1.J0.

G01Y-16.

G03X1.Y-1.I0.J1.

G01X32.

G03X1.Y1.I-1.J0.

G01Y8.

G40G01X-17.

M17(M99)

精銑等高

刀具:Φ6

Siemens 固定循環

鑽中心孔 CYCLE81(RTP,RFP,SDIS,DP) [4個參數]

RTP: 鑽孔結束時主軸提刀高度

RFP: 參考面

SDIS: 安全距離(正值)

DP: 中心孔底部坐標值


Siemens 固定循環

固定循環

鑽深孔 CYCLE83(RTP,RFP,SDIS,DP﹐﹐FDEP,,DAM,DTB,DTS,FRF,VARI)

RTP﹑ RFP﹑ SDIS﹑DP 同 CYCLE81 參數

FDEP:第一次下刀深度坐標

DAM:每次下刀深度(正值)

DTB:斷削時間

DTS:排削時間

FRF:第一刀進給系數

VARI:加工方式(斷削0與排削1)


固定循環

Siemens 固定循環

搪孔 CYCLE86(RTP,RFP,SDIS,DP﹐﹐FDEP,DAM,DTB,DTS,FRF,VARI)

RTP﹑ RFP﹑ SDIS﹑DP 同 CYCLE81 參數

FDEP:搪刀在孔底部停頓時間

DAM:主軸正反轉

DTB:X軸偏移量(有正負區分)

DTS:Y軸偏移量(有正負區分)

FRF:Z軸偏移量(有正負區分)

VARI:主軸角度(要與X.Y偏移量對應)


固定循環

FANUC 固定循環

鑽中心孔 G81X0.YO.Z-1.5R3.F200 [4個參數]

X0.Y0.: 第一孔中心坐標

Z-1.5: 鑽孔深度

R3.: 安全距離(正值)

F200: 鑽孔速度


固定循環

FANUC 固定循環

鑽深孔 G83X0.Y0.Z-15.R3.Q3.F200

X0.Y0.,Z-15.,R3.,F200 同 G81 參數

Q3.:每一次鑽孔深度

搪孔 G76X0.Y0.Z-15.R3.Q0.1F200

X0.Y0.,Z-15.,R3.,F200 同 G81 參數

Q0.1:搪刀偏移量

(注﹕搪刀刀尖應朝向芯片相反方向)


固定循環

FANUC 固定循環

鉸孔 G85X0.Y0.Z-15.R3.F200

X0.Y0.,Z-15.,R3.,F200 同 G81 參數

沉頭孔 G82X0.Y0.Z-15.R3.P5F200

X0.Y0.,Z-15.,R3.,F200 同 G81 參數

P5:沉頭底部暫停時間

排孔加工模式

圓周孔 G34X0.Y0.I20.J30.K20

X0.Y0.:圓周孔中心坐標 I:圓半徑

J:最初孔角度 K:孔個數

圓弧孔 G36X0.Y0.I20.J30.P30.K30

X0.Y0.:圓弧孔中心坐標 I:圓弧半徑

J:最初孔角度 P:角度間距

K:孔個數

固定循環

排孔加工模式

角度孔 G35X0.Y0.I20.J30.K20

X0.Y0.:起始坐標 I:孔間距

J:角度 K:孔個數

圓弧孔 G37.1X0.Y0.I20.J30.P30K30

X0.Y0.:起始坐標 I:X軸間距

J:Y軸間距 P:X軸孔數

K:Y軸孔數

固定循環

舉例 1

Siemens與FANUC手動編程的區別

深孔加工

FFWON

SOFT

G64

T1D1

G90G00G54Z150.

X0.Y0.

M03S1600

Z100.

MCALL CYCLE 83 (10,0,5,-40,-2,3,0,0,0.5,1)

G00X0.Y0.

X-40.Y20.

X-40.Y-20.

MCALL

FFWOF

M30

FANUC

G91G28Z0.

G90G40G49G80

G00G54Z150.

X0.Y0.

M03S1600

G00Z100.

G00X0.Y0.

G98G83X0.Y0.Z-40.R3.Q3.F200

G00X-40.Y20.

X-40.Y-20.

G80

G90G00Z150.

M30


分享到:


相關文章: